NTSB Cites Pilot Error in SpaceShipTwo Crash Report

The National Transportation Safety Board has concluded its investigation into the fatal accident involving Virgin Galactic’s SpaceShipTwo. The space ship disintegrated during a test flight on October 31, 2014, resulting in the death of copilot Michael Alsbury.
